45 OAK DRIVE is a very small semi-detached house of 78m², built sometime between 1983 and 1990. It was last sold for £142,000 in April 2015, which was around 36% below the average April 2015 detached price in the East Riding of Yorkshire local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was December 2013,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the East Riding of Yorkshire local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The five 45 OAK DRIVE sales between January 2000 and April 2015 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the March 2012 sale was for 39%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 39% below the HPI over time, until the April 2015 sale, where it rises to 36%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 36% below the HPI.
